Output 39e3aa79a8f882b0166b5b25fb85a4086630a4db3761494d114cc148f3721db0:4

value
316522198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c89ba83b6b4048b81ca9b6227ef4af75e36b9168 OP_EQUALVERIFY OP_CHECKSIG
address
1KHiccfdmYS9sBGKdJWnnDF1su3cdBgDrw
transaction
39e3aa79a8f882b0166b5b25fb85a4086630a4db3761494d114cc148f3721db0
spent
true